Where might the Mayweather-Pacquiao rematch take place?
The fight's location is still undecided, but the Sphere in Las Vegas is a leading candidate. Reports from AP News suggest that the venue has not been officially confirmed yet, leaving fans guessing. Other potential venues could include major arenas in Las Vegas or possibly international locations, but nothing has been finalized.

Why is the venue still undecided?
The venue remains undecided because the fight is being treated more as an exhibition than a traditional competitive bout. Floyd Mayweather has emphasized the entertainment aspect, and negotiations are likely considering factors like audience capacity, broadcasting rights, and event logistics. This flexibility allows both fighters to focus on creating a spectacle rather than a competitive fight.

Are there other upcoming exhibitions involving these fighters?
Yes, Floyd Mayweather has a history of participating in exhibition bouts, including with Mike Tyson and kickboxers. These events are more about entertainment and leveraging their fame rather than competitive sports. Fans can expect more exhibitions in the future, as fighters and promoters continue to explore the spectacle side of combat sports.

Will this fight affect their official records?
Since the fight is being billed as an exhibition, it will not impact Floyd Mayweather or Manny Pacquiao's official professional records. These bouts are considered entertainment events, allowing fighters to showcase their skills without affecting their competitive legacy.
